The University of Pittsburgh women’s soccer program, has announced the signing of Nigerian midfielder Adoo Philomina Yina from NWFL side Nasarawa Amazons, www.aclsports.com reports.
Born on December 30, 2004, Yina arrives with an impressive resume, having represented Nigeria at both the U-17 and U-20 levels. She was a key figure in both teams, showcasing her talent on the international stage and cementing her reputation as one of Nigeria’s brightest young football prospects.
Yina also earned a silver medal in football at the 2023 African Games and was named Player of the Match in Nigeria’s group-stage clash against Korea Republic at the FIFA U-20 Women’s World Cup.
She made her senior debut for the Super Falcons in a friendly match against France in 2024, marking a significant milestone in her growing career.
